(Justin Sullivan/Getty Images) By Philissa Cramer June 08, 2022 ( JTA ) — Voters in San Francisco have recalled Chesa Boudin, the local district attorney who sought to change policing in that city and came to represent one extreme of a polarizing debate over criminal justice in America.
